Black Kandy Kush by Hybrid Department

Black Kandy Kush is a hybrid strain developed by Hybrid Department, known for its balanced genetic profile and unique sensory characteristics. This strain offers a nuanced experience, combining relaxing indica traits with uplifting sativa qualities, making it suitable for a variety of users.

Appearance

Black Kandy Kush presents visually striking buds, often displaying deep, dark hues interspersed with vibrant greens and purples. These dense nugs are typically covered in a frosty layer of trichomes, giving them a glistening appearance. Cultivators note their sticky texture due to a significant resin content, and they may exhibit unique, sometimes crooked, shapes.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ma of Black Kandy Kush is complex, featuring sweet, candy-like notes upon initial scent, evolving to include hints of citrus, pine, and lemon as the plant matures. Its flavor profile harmonizes these elements, offering a rich, velvety candy taste complemented by herbal undertones, refreshing citrus, and an earthy base.

Effects

This strain is recognized for delivering subtle yet profound effects, characterized by deep relaxation without significant psychoactive impairment, largely due to its low THC content. Users often report a sense of calm and enhanced mental clarity, making it conducive to stress reduction and unwinding. The experience is typically described as a gentle uplift in mood and mild euphoria.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

Black Kandy Kush is distinguished by its cannabinoid composition, featuring low THC levels (under 0.7%) and notably high CBD content, typically ranging from 8% to 12%. Key terpenes identified include limonene, myrcene, and caryophyllene, contributing to its signature aroma, flavor, and therapeutic properties. Limonene offers citrus notes and mood elevation, myrcene provides earthy balance and relaxation, while caryophyllene adds a spicy element and interacts with cannabinoid receptors.

Origins & Lineage

Developed by Hybrid Department, Black Kandy Kush is the result of extensive breeding and research aimed at merging the best indica and sativa genetics. It is considered a balanced hybrid with approximately a 50:50 indica-sativa ratio. Its lineage draws about 60% from classic Kush varieties, known for robust growth, and 40% from sativa lines, contributing to its aromatic complexity.
